Calling the Hotline gets you through to a 3rd party Telephone Receptionist who takes down all the details you give them, however that's where the 3rd party services end, after that, the information is passed to your STL and ETL HR for them to investigate the situation, and as someone else said, usually it leads to alot of work place stress for the person who calls. The integrity hotline is pretty much a "do or die" scenario for store Leadership. Hotline calls are often taken by the Group HR leader or a designated ETL-HR with years of experience. After a hotline call is made, reports are sent to district, group and Corporate level HR's and actions plans are created and must be carried out with 30 days. When calling you have the opportunity to remain anonymous and trust me, you will remain anonymous. If a store gets 2 or more hotline calls in a year, your HR and STL are put under a microscope for awhile. Expect more visits than usual from District level and higher people if this happens.

Yes, they take these calls seriously.
